Or. Admin. Code § 632-037-0015 - State and Federal Agency Coordination
(1) When a mining operation is proposed on
federal land, the Department shall, when agreed to by the federal agency, enter
into a memorandum of agreement with the federal agency that is designated as
the lead agency for the proposed mine under the National Environmental Policy
Act. The purpose of a memorandum of agreement shall be to coordinate the state
consolidated application process established in ORS
517.952 to
517.989 with the federal
application process to the fullest extent possible.
(2) The memorandum of agreement may:
(a) Provide for the selection of the same
third party contractor, if any, to prepare the environmental evaluation and
socioeconomic impact analysis required by ORS
517.952 to
517.989 and the environmental
assessment or environmental impact statement required by the National
Environmental Policy Act;
(b)
Coordinate the timeliness for preparation and content of the environmental
evaluation and the environmental assessment or environmental impact statement;
(c) Ensure that all data,
information and documents prepared in satisfaction of the requirements of ORS
517.952 to
517.989 will also satisfy to the
fullest extent possible the requirements of corresponding portions of the
National Environmental Policy Act; and
(d) Ensure that the state and federal
financial security requirements are coordinated to the fullest extent
possible.
